Как узнать сколько потоков в процессоре

Как узнать сколько потоков в процессоре

Как узнать сколько потоков в процессоре

Категория: Железо и периферия / Процессор
Добавил:
access_timeОпубликовано: 25-06-2021
visibilityПросмотров: 11 104
chat_bubble_outlineКомментариев: 0

При выборе процессора недостаточно обращать внимание на какую-то одну его техническую характеристику, важно учитывать все параметры, поскольку то, что непрофессионалу нередко представляется несущественным, на деле играет главную роль. Например, большинство пользователей придерживаются той точки зрения, согласно которой чем больше ядер имеет процессор, тем он производительней. Это верно, но далеко не всегда. Так, если сравнить результаты тестов производительности четырехядерных процессоров от Intel и восьмиядерных процессоров от AMD, то можно будет увидеть, что в большинстве случаев первые оказываются более производительными, чем вторые. Почему? Потому что производительные возможности CPU обуславливаются не только количеством ядер, но и другими параметрами, например, количеством потоков. Но что такое потоки и как узнать, сколько потоков поддерживается процессором?

Как узнать сколько потоков в процессоре

Процессоры и их ядра

Без преувеличения можно сказать, что процессор является центральным и самым важным аппаратным компонентом любого компьютера или умного мобильного гаджета, его нередко называют мозгом, что вполне справедливо, ведь именно процессор получает, обрабатывает и распределяет информацию между другими важными аппаратными узлами — оперативной памятью, видеокартой, жесткими дисками и так далее. Сам процессор состоит из следующих компонентов:

• Интерфейса системной шины.

• Контроллера оперативной памяти.

• Буферной памяти.

• Одного, двух или более ядер. 

Чем более мощным является процессор, тем быстрее он справляется с возложенными на него задачами. В свою очередь, производительность процессора зависит от ряда факторов, например, от тактовой частоты — буквально количества команд, которые процессор способен выполнить в единицу времени. Увеличить производительность процессора можно путем увеличения его тактовой частоты, однако на деле это может привести и приводит к серьезным техническим проблемам, поэтому инженеры стали создавать процессоры с несколькими ядрами, распределяя нагрузку между несколькими вычислительными центрами, коими и являются ядра. Говоря простым языком, ядро — это физический компонент процессора, непосредственно выполняющий все логические и арифметические операции. Если хотите, ядро процессора является для него тем же, чем процессор является для компьютера — мозгом.

Что такое потоки

Если ядро является самостоятельным физическим блоком в архитектуре процессора, то поток — это программно выделенная область в ядре. Упрощенно говоря, поток — это виртуальное ядро, которое операционная система воспринимает как самостоятельный вычислительный центр. Такое распределение вычислительных мощностей на потоки называется гиперпоточностью, или иначе Hyper-threading. Сама по себе гиперпоточность не делает процессор мощнее, его вычислительный потенциал остается прежним, но ресурсы процессора используются более рационально, что и обуславливает его более высокую производительность. 

d0bad0b0d0ba d183d0b7d0bdd0b0d182d18c d181d0bad0bed0bbd18cd0bad0be d0bfd0bed182d0bed0bad0bed0b2 d0b2 d0bfd180d0bed186d0b5d181d181d0be 65d271536abcb

Как определить количество потоков в CPU

Теперь, когда вы имеете общее представление о ядрах и потоках, перейдем к нашему основному вопросу: как определить количество потоков в процессоре. Это не так уже и сложно, вам даже не понадобятся сторонние утилиты. 

Диспетчер задач и Диспетчер устройств

Просмотреть количество ядер CPU в работающей системе можно с помощью всем известных Диспетчера задач и Диспетчера устройств. Запустите первый любым удобным вам способом, переключитесь на вкладку «Производительность» и посмотрите, сколько Диспетчер задач показывает логических процессоров. Оно то и будет соответствовать количеству потоков. Кстати, чуть выше будет указано и количество физических ядер процессора. 

d0bad0b0d0ba d183d0b7d0bdd0b0d182d18c d181d0bad0bed0bbd18cd0bad0be d0bfd0bed182d0bed0bad0bed0b2 d0b2 d0bfd180d0bed186d0b5d181d181d0be 65d27153c0c72Диспетчер устройств не столь информативен, но для дела сгодится и он. Откройте его и разверните пункт «Процессоры». Сколько процессоров будет показано, столько и потоков будет в вашем процессоре. Диспетчером задач как самостоятельные вычислительные единицы идентифицируются не только физические ядра, но и потоки.

d0bad0b0d0ba d183d0b7d0bdd0b0d182d18c d181d0bad0bed0bbd18cd0bad0be d0bfd0bed182d0bed0bad0bed0b2 d0b2 d0bfd180d0bed186d0b5d181d181d0be 65d2715412a6f

Сторонние программы

Если на компьютере у вас имеются такие программы как CPU-Z, Speccy или Process Explorer, пожалуйста, можете использовать их. В CPU-Z интересующую вас информацию можно найти на вкладке CPU, количество потоков соответствует значению параметра Threads. 

d0bad0b0d0ba d183d0b7d0bdd0b0d182d18c d181d0bad0bed0bbd18cd0bad0be d0bfd0bed182d0bed0bad0bed0b2 d0b2 d0bfd180d0bed186d0b5d181d181d0be 65d271545a40bВ Speccy нужно перейти в раздел «Центральный процессор», в котором количество потоков будет указано в начале списка технических характеристик. Потоки — такое-то количество. 

d0bad0b0d0ba d183d0b7d0bdd0b0d182d18c d181d0bad0bed0bbd18cd0bad0be d0bfd0bed182d0bed0bad0bed0b2 d0b2 d0bfd180d0bed186d0b5d181d181d0be 65d271547c2d4Наконец, в Process Explorer количество логических процессоров, то бишь потоков, можно просмотреть в окошке SystemInformation. Чтобы его открыть, кликните по миниатюре с графиком загруженности процессора, а когда окно откроется, посмотрите значение Logical Processors (логические процессоры). 

d0bad0b0d0ba d183d0b7d0bdd0b0d182d18c d181d0bad0bed0bbd18cd0bad0be d0bfd0bed182d0bed0bad0bed0b2 d0b2 d0bfd180d0bed186d0b5d181d181d0be 65d27154c1798d0bad0b0d0ba d183d0b7d0bdd0b0d182d18c d181d0bad0bed0bbd18cd0bad0be d0bfd0bed182d0bed0bad0bed0b2 d0b2 d0bfd180d0bed186d0b5d181d181d0be 65d271551cea3Ну что же, теперь вы в курсе, как узнать количество потоков в процессоре. Тут, наверное, у наших читателей может возникнуть вопрос: получается, чем больше потоков в CPU, тем он мощнее? И да, и нет, многое зависит от того, какая операционная система используется, и какая программа исполняется. Если программа не поддерживает многопоточность, в процессе работы с ней особого повышения производительности вы не ощутите.

tagsКлючевые слова
     Рекомендуем другие статьи по данной теме
Ctrl
Enter
Заметили ошибку

Выделите и нажмите Ctrl+Enter

Железо и периферия, Процессор
Как узнать сколько потоков в процессоре